网络信息采集如何应对网络爬虫风险?

在当今信息爆炸的时代,网络信息采集已成为各行各业获取数据、洞察市场的重要手段。然而,随着网络爬虫技术的不断发展,网络信息采集面临着前所未有的风险。如何应对网络爬虫风险,保障信息采集的合法权益,成为众多企业和个人关注的焦点。本文将从以下几个方面探讨网络信息采集如何应对网络爬虫风险。

一、了解网络爬虫及其风险

  1. 网络爬虫概述

网络爬虫(Web Crawler)是一种自动化程序,通过模拟人类浏览器的行为,对互联网上的网页进行抓取,以获取网页上的信息。网络爬虫广泛应用于搜索引擎、数据挖掘、舆情监测等领域。


  1. 网络爬虫风险

(1)信息泄露:网络爬虫在抓取信息的过程中,可能会获取到敏感数据,如用户隐私、商业机密等,从而引发信息泄露风险。

(2)服务器压力:大量网络爬虫同时访问同一网站,可能导致服务器瘫痪,影响网站正常运行。

(3)版权纠纷:部分网络爬虫在抓取信息时,可能侵犯网站版权,引发法律纠纷。

二、应对网络爬虫风险的策略

  1. 加强网站防护

(1)设置robots.txt:robots.txt文件用于告诉搜索引擎哪些页面可以抓取,哪些页面禁止抓取。通过合理设置robots.txt,可以防止网络爬虫抓取敏感页面。

(2)使用验证码:在登录、注册等关键页面设置验证码,可以有效阻止自动化程序登录。

(3)限制IP访问:对频繁访问网站的IP进行限制,降低网络爬虫的攻击风险。


  1. 优化信息采集策略

(1)合理分配爬虫资源:根据网站规模和业务需求,合理分配爬虫资源,避免过度抓取。

(2)采用分布式爬虫:将爬虫任务分散到多个节点,降低对单个节点的压力。

(3)关注爬虫行为:实时监控爬虫行为,及时发现异常情况,及时采取措施。


  1. 加强法律法规意识

(1)了解相关法律法规:熟悉《中华人民共和国网络安全法》、《中华人民共和国著作权法》等相关法律法规,确保信息采集合法合规。

(2)尊重网站版权:在信息采集过程中,尊重网站版权,避免侵犯他人合法权益。

(3)加强内部管理:建立健全内部管理制度,确保信息采集过程合法合规。

三、案例分析

  1. 案例一:某电商平台在信息采集过程中,未设置robots.txt,导致大量网络爬虫抓取用户隐私信息,引发用户投诉和媒体关注。

  2. 案例二:某互联网公司开发了一款爬虫工具,用于抓取竞争对手的网站数据。在抓取过程中,未遵守相关法律法规,侵犯了竞争对手的版权,最终被诉至法院。

四、总结

网络信息采集在为企业和个人带来便利的同时,也面临着网络爬虫风险。通过加强网站防护、优化信息采集策略、加强法律法规意识等措施,可以有效应对网络爬虫风险,保障信息采集的合法权益。在信息时代,企业和个人应时刻关注网络爬虫风险,不断提升自身的信息安全防护能力。

猜你喜欢:业务性能指标